Output 311c672032961328bccd9b8bc724a49e510b0c6f476bfb29afb66701d08d9465:0

value
19818225585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7429e1c7b1f90fda8e15d486def357db93be92a OP_EQUALVERIFY OP_CHECKSIG
address
DMr6136W5rsCW1E6YYa2HAh5v8rfDfe6vA
transaction
311c672032961328bccd9b8bc724a49e510b0c6f476bfb29afb66701d08d9465